The only way to tell for sure is to go to the doc and let them have a look at the rash, or to have the celiac blood screening panel, or allergy testing!. Some celiacs with herpeformitis can react to having wheat germ oil in their shampoo and soaps, so it really could be either!.

Do you have the same reaction when you touch any other gluten products that are non-wheat based (barley, rye, spelt, graham, durhum, etc!.)!? you could try dipping your hands into rye flour to see what happens, lol!
Good luck and honestly, I would just go to the doc and let them know!. If it is allergies, then you need to get that addressed!. If your hands are swelling etc!. and it is allergies they may want to give you an epi pen and get you on antihistamines!.
